Community Tasting Notes 23

  • ThijsV Likes this wine: 92 points

    May 31, 2023 - BYOB dinner NOTK (Supernova hotel, Rotterdam): Rustic, hint of barnyard, black fruit, cherries, leather. Still very nice, not yet over its peak

    1 person found this helpful Comment
  • jdinkin1 wrote: 88 points

    May 26, 2023 - Surprisingly fruit forward. Almost jammy. Has acid and still a bit of tannin. But lacking structure. Overall disappointing

  • EhrlichDY wrote:

    April 10, 2023 - Popped and poured. This was really good from the start. Showing sweet fruit and the character of somewhat ripe 2009 vintage along with some secondary development. Dinking well now so not sure why one would continue to age these.

  • Pinot_Geek Likes this wine: 91 points

    April 4, 2023 - Ripe blackberries and apricots, solidly tooth-gripping tannins, low-med acid. 13.5% Alc.
    A big rustic bruiser of a Burgundy, not super complex, but a tasty glass. Approachable now, and years of life to go.
